torino, piemonte.


coming from milano, torino always feels very much refreshing. visited the city twice, going around the city center (and the stadium which is almost in the outskirt), it's always a pleasant walk although i have to say that it's not like what i've always imagined. known as industrial city, i didn't really expect such beauty of architecture, neo-classical, renaissance, art deco, etc. the scale of the buildings in the city center somehow reminds me of those in genova. the city is layouted in grid, makes it easy to navigate. and the neon signage system on the buildings definitely gets me. on both visits i didn't have much time exploring the city, but i'm sure it offers much more than what i've already got.
